      46-251.   Failure to file true statement of substantial interestsdefined and classified as crime.Failure to file true statement of substantial interests is intentionally(a) failing to file a statement of substantial interests as required bythis act, or

      (b)   filing a statement of substantial interests that contains any falsestatement.

      Failure to file a true statement of substantial interests is a class Bmisdemeanor.

      History:   L. 1974, ch. 353, § 37; L. 1975, ch. 272, § 13; July 1.
